The Expressions And Clinical Significance Of SATB1 And TFF3 In Gastric Cancer

Objective:Gastric cancer(GC)as the third largest cause of cancer-related death worldwide,has become one of the more serious disease burdens in China.Although the incidence of GC has declined by changing lifestyle and improving public health conditions,there is basically no treatment that can substantially improve the survival time of GC.The reason is that most of the patients have developed to the middle and late stages at the time of diagnosis.It is more important to explore markers for predicting tumor progression and patient survival.Based on the differential expression of the Special AT-rich Binding protein-1(SATB1)and the trefoil factor 3(TFF3)in GC,this study used a public database to explore the expression of SATB1 and TFF3 in gastric cancer and their correlation with the degree of gastric malignancy,and preliminarily verified pathologically,which provided an important experimental basis for the diagnosis and prognosis of gastric cancer.Methods:1.Pub Med,Webof Science,CNKI,Wanfang and VIPR databases were used to search the literatures published before December 30,2022,and screened according to the inclusion criteria.Odds ratio(OR)was used as a parameter to evaluate the expression level of SATB1 in GC tissues.Use STATA17.0software to integrate and complete the statistical analysis.In the analysis,when P< 0.05 or 95% CI did not include a value of 1,the combined results were considered to be statistically significant.2.TIMER2.0,GEPIA2 and UALCAN databases were used to explore the expression of TFF3 m RNA in GC,and GEPIA2 and Kaplan-Meier Plotter databases were used to analyze the prognostic value of TFF3 in GC.3.The expression of SATB1 and TFF3 in 40 patients with GC was detected by immunohistochemical method,and the relationship between the expression of SATB1 and TFF3 and clinicopathology and the correlation between them were analyzed.The chi-square test or Fisher’s exact method in SPSS23.0 was used for analysis,the correlation between SATB1 and TFF3 was analyzed by Spearman method,and P<0.05 was defined as meaningful.Results:1.Meta-analysis was used to analyze 14 studies(1052 patients).The results showed that the high expression of SATB1 was found in cancer tissue(OR=13.55,95%CI: 6.58-27.93,P<0.00001),old age(OR=1.89,95%CI: 1.45-2.47,P<0.0001),larger cancer focus(OR=1.37,95%CI: 1.00-1.88,P=0.049),lymphatic invasion(OR=3.69,95%CI: 2.39-5.71,P<0.0001),deeper invasion(OR=2.76,95%CI: 2.07-3.68,P<0.00001)and advanced stage(OR=3.78,95%CI: 2.79-5.11,P<0.0001),but not related to sex,location of cancer focus and degree of differentiation.2.The expression level of TFF3 m RNA in GC tissues was significantly higher than that in normal tissues,and the high expression of TFF3 m RNA in GC patients was related to cancer stage.In addition,survival analysis showed that the overall survival time of GC patients was associated with TFF3 m RNA expression.3.In 40 cases of GC,the positive rate of SATB1 was 62.5%(25/40).The expression of SATB1 was high in large cancer foci,lymph node metastasis,deep invasion and advanced stage(P<0.05).However,the sex,age,location of cancer focus,differentiation,vascular and nerve invasion were not related to the expression of SATB1(P>0.05).The positive expression rate of SATB1 was 70%(28/40)in 40 GC patients.The high expression of TFF3 was significantly correlated with deeper invasion and advanced stage of GC(P<0.05).No correlation was found between TFF3 expression and sex,age,size and location of cancer focus,differentiation,Lymphatic invasion,vascular and nerve invasion(P>0.05).Conclusions:1.SATB1 is highly expressed in GC,which is positively correlated with the development of tumor,so SATB1 can be used as a diagnostic marker for GC.2.Compared with normal tissues,the expression of TFF3 m RNA in GC tissues is increased,and it is significantly correlated with the overall survival time of GC.It can be used as a prognostic marker of GC.3.There is a positive correlation between the expression of SATB1 in GC and the expression of TFF3,so the diagnosis of combined SATB1 and TFF3 has a potential application prospect.Figure 17 Table 10 Reference 79...
